EmailBuilder ai is a visual email design tool that allows users to create responsive templates using a drag-and-drop interface or an MJML code editor. It is designed for solo creators, marketing agencies, and growing teams who need to build emails that render across various email clients.

The platform focuses on design and construction rather than delivery; users export their templates to connected email service providers (ESPs). It includes AI tools to help generate copy, subject lines, and images, and a feature to convert forwarded emails into editable templates.

Buyers should confirm that while it integrates with many platforms, it is a builder; the actual sending of emails occurs through the user's chosen ESP. Users should also check AI call limits associated with different pricing tiers to ensure they align with their production volume.

Key Features

Drag-and-Drop Builder

A visual editor for creating responsive emails without writing code.

AI Chat Assistant

Supports rewriting text, changing tone, generating subject lines, and creating images.

MJML Rendering

Uses the MJML framework to create HTML designed to render consistently across different email clients.

Inspiration Inbox

Allows users to forward emails to a unique address and use AI to convert them into editable templates.

Virtual Email Previews

Simulates how emails look on devices such as iPhones and iPads within the builder.

MCP Server Connection

Supports connections to AI assistants like ChatGPT, Claude, and Gemini to build emails via text descriptions.

RSS to Email

Pulls content from RSS or Atom feeds to generate newsletters.

Reusable Modules

Allows users to create and save branded components for use across multiple campaigns.

FAQ

Does EmailBuilder ai send the emails for me?

No, EmailBuilder ai is a design tool. You create the templates in the platform and then export or connect them to your own email service provider (ESP) for sending.

What is the difference between the Maestro and Studio plans?

The Maestro plan starts at $39/mo with 200 AI calls, while the Studio plan ($199/mo) supports up to 3 users, provides unlimited AI assistant calls, and includes automated newsletters.

Can I create emails without using the drag-and-drop editor?

Yes, the tool includes an MJML code editor and an MCP server that allows you to build emails using AI assistants like ChatGPT or Claude via text descriptions.
